The average rent in West Laurel is $2,462 per month as of September 2026. This is 30% above the national average rent, or $562 more per month.

Rent prices in West Laurel v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in West Laurel is $2,040, whereas a house costs $3,000. 1-bedroom apartments in West Laurel run $1,860 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$2,216.

How much is rent in West Laurel?

The average rent in West Laurel is $2,462 per month as of September 12, 2026.

Is rent up or down in West Laurel?

Average rent prices in West Laurel have increased by 23% since last year.

How does West Laurel rent compare to the national average?

Rent in West Laurel is 30% above the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$562 more per month.

What salary do I need to afford rent in West Laurel?

To comfortably afford rent in West Laurel, you'd need to earn approximately $99,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
